Chris was on the site the first day, and helped me make several critical decisions that could only be made once the work had started, such as where to locate two additional air intakes needed for the new high-efficiency furnace. He kept me informed of everyone's schedule until the work was done. He then came back after the work had been inspected to walk me through the instructions for our new systems and to help me complete the paperwork for the Mass Save rebates.
Both new construction and remodeling seem to be back almost to pre-2008 levels in our community (Newton). As a result, it took 3-plus months to get our home assessed and applications approved through the Mass Save program, get competing bids from contractors, and get our new systems inspected once they were installed (this is no reflection on the city's inspectors - because I work at Newton City Hall, I know they are all working at over 100 percent of capacity).
Attardo Heating and AIr Conditioning did the actual work in about 2 days (including about 3 hours to empty and remove our old basement oil tank).. Working with Chris, his employees and subcontractors was the fastest and easiest part of the process, and we are happy with our new heating system.
